Întrebări frecvente și sfaturi ascunse

Tot ceea ce vrei de fapt să știi înainte de a rezerva.

Is parking guaranteed?

No. It's £15/day on a first-come, first-served basis. Arrive early or have a backup plan (Queen Street NCP).

How far is the walk to the Shambles?

About 15-20 minutes. It's a pleasant walk past Micklegate Bar and into the city walls.

Is it dog friendly?

Yes, very. £25 per dog per night, and they get a bed and bowls. Dogs allowed in the bar/lounge but not the main bistro.

Does the hotel have a lift?

Only in certain parts. The historic main house relies mostly on stairs. Request a ground floor room if mobility is a concern.

Is breakfast worth the £24?

It's a high-quality buffet plus cooked-to-order options, but you can find excellent brunch for half the price on Bishopthorpe Road nearby.

What is the 'Minster' annex?

A separate building block at the rear. It lacks the Georgian history of the main house but offers quieter, more modern rooms.
